news 2026/6/10 20:39:35

Jira:工程团队的“单一工作事实源”

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Jira:工程团队的“单一工作事实源”

在谈项目管理工具时,Jira 这个名字几乎绕不过去。对很多软件团队来说,“建个 Jira 任务”已经和“写个函数”“提个 PR”一样,成了日常工作语言的一部分。本文从技术博客的视角,尝试回答三个问题:

  • Jira 本质上解决的是什么问题?

  • 它是怎么通过一套“问题与工作流模型”支撑不同团队的?

  • 工程团队在落地 Jira 时,应该关注哪些实践与坑?

Jira 是什么:从缺陷跟踪到通用工作流引擎

Jira 最早出现在缺陷跟踪场景,用来记录 bug、任务、改进需求等“问题(Issue)”,并管理从创建、分配、处理到关闭的全生命周期。 随着功能演进,它逐渐扩展为一个通用的项目管理与工作项跟踪平台,支持软件开发、IT 运维、运营、市场等各种团队协作。

它的底层理念可以简化为两点:

  • 万物皆“问题”:Bug、故事、任务、请求、工单,统一抽象为 Issue。

  • 一切靠“工作流”:通过可配置的状态与流转,来约束和可视化工作过程。

这种抽象让 Jira 在不同业务场景下都保持了一致的使用体验,又通过高度配置化保持灵活性。

核心能力:Issue、项目、敏捷与报表

从功能模块来看,Jira 的核心能力可以归纳成四个部分。

1. 问题与任务管理

  • 多类型 Issue:支持 Bug、Story、Task、Epic 等不同问题类型,并可自定义字段与界面,用于承载不同粒度和性质的工作。

  • 生命周期跟踪:每个 Issue 从“待办”到“进行中”再到“已完成/已关闭”,都有明确的状态流转记录,便于审计和追踪责任。

  • 权限与通知:可以针对不同角色控制可见性与可操作性,通过评论、@ 人、邮件通知保持沟通同步。

2. 项目空间与配置

  • 项目级配置:每个项目可以有独立的问题类型方案、权限方案、通知方案和工作流配置,适配不同团队的工作方式。

  • 自定义字段:支持为项目添加自定义字段,如“模块”“环境”“严重等级”,方便结构化数据统计与筛选。

  • 仪表盘:通过可视化小部件将关键指标(未解决问题数、按优先级分布、个人任务列表)集中展示。

3. 敏捷开发支持(Scrum / Kanban)

  • 敏捷看板:Scrum 看板支撑迭代开发,Kanban 看板适用于持续流式交付,均支持拖拽进行状态变更和 WIP 限制。

  • 待办列表与规划:支持对 Product Backlog 进行优先级排序、估点、拆分与分配,为每个 Sprint 制定计划。​

  • 经典敏捷报表:内置燃尽图、速度图、累积流图等,帮助团队评估迭代完成度、吞吐量和流程瓶颈。

4. 报表与分析

  • 现成报表:包括按经办人、状态、版本的统计,Sprint 报告,版本报告等,可快速洞察项目健康度。

  • 自定义仪表板与过滤器:支持使用 JQL(Jira Query Language)构建复杂查询,并将结果以图表或列表形式组件化展示。

  • 历史数据洞察:结合时间线数据,分析周期时间、瓶颈环节,为流程优化提供依据。

灵活的工作流与生态集成

Jira 真正的“杀手锏”不在 UI,而在于可高度定制的工作流模型和丰富的生态集成能力。

自定义工作流:把业务过程显式化

  • 状态(Status):例如“待处理 → 开发中 → 测试中 → 已上线 → 已关闭”。

  • 转换(Transition):控制不同角色在什么条件下可以把 Issue 从一个状态流转到另一个状态。

  • 条件与后置操作:可在转换时触发自动操作,比如自动分配经办人、更新字段、发送通知或创建子任务。

通过可视化工作流编辑器,团队可以把约定俗成的流程正式固化下来,实现“流程即配置”。

丰富集成:构建开发工具链的中枢

  • 与代码托管工具集成:如 GitHub、GitLab 等,将分支、提交、PR 与 Issue 关联,实现“从需求到代码”的可追踪链路。

  • 与 CI/CD 系统集成:例如 Jenkins、Bitbucket Pipelines 等,可在构建和部署完成后自动更新 Issue 状态或写入构建信息。

  • 与知识库系统集成:常见是与 Confluence 结合,需求文档、设计文档与 Jira Issue 双向关联,形成较完整的知识闭环。

插件生态(Marketplace)进一步扩展了 Jira 的能力,从测试管理、文档生成到跨项目组合管理,都有成熟解决方案。

从工具到实践:Jira 在团队中的最佳使用姿势

仅仅“用上 Jira”并不自动带来效率提升,很多团队反而踩过“配置过度复杂、字段泛滥、流程臃肿”的坑。 从实践角度看,几个经验值得注意:

  1. 让工作流服务团队,而不是反过来

    • 刚开始时保持工作流简洁,只包含对团队有实际决策意义的状态。

    • 随着成熟度提高,再逐步引入更精细的状态与自动化规则。

  2. 控制字段数量,保持数据可用

    • 每多一个必填字段,就多一分填写成本和错误空间。

    • 只保留那些后续真的会用于过滤、统计或决策的字段,其余可以放在描述或评论中。

  3. 把敏捷仪式与 Jira 紧密绑定

    • Sprint 规划会、站会、复盘会都以 Jira 看板和报表为中心展开,让工具成为团队共识载体。

    • 利用燃尽图、Sprint 报告等回顾承诺与完成情况,而不是凭印象争论。

  4. 把 Jira 当“单一事实源”

    • 要么“不进 Jira 就不算正式需求/任务”,要么就不要指望用它做完整管理。

    • 所有重要工作项在 Jira 中都有对应 Issue,所有状态变更以 Jira 为准,减少“口头优先级”带来的混乱。

结语:Jira 更像是一种“工作方式”

从技术博客视角看,Jira 不是“某个公司内部必须用的指定软件”,而是敏捷实践和工程化管理的一种具体载体。它通过统一的 Issue 模型、可配置的工作流,以及与开发工具链的集成,把“如何组织工作”这件事从口头约定变成可执行的系统行为。

真正决定 Jira 价值的,不是它有多少功能,而是团队是否愿意围绕它形成一致的工作习惯:

  • 所有需求、缺陷和任务都在一个地方被追踪;

  • 流程规则在工具中清晰体现,而不是散落在每个人的脑子里;

  • 决策尽量基于看得见的数据,而不是感觉和记忆。

当这三点成立时,Jira 不再只是一个“项目管理工具”,而更接近于团队的“操作系统”。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 12:02:25

PC 端(Windows/macOS)和 iOS 端的系统架构、安全机制差异有多大?

在日常上网中,误点邮件、短信或网页中的恶意链接是常见场景。很多用户认为 “只要没下载恶意文件、没安装木马,就不会有风险”,但实际情况并非如此。 恶意链接的危害并非仅依赖 “下载文件” 触发,其可通过浏览器漏洞、脚本执行、…

作者头像 李华
网站建设 2026/6/10 11:20:18

Ollama创业神话:从爱好者到身家1065万,他的3步逆袭全流程(附实操代码)

一、普通人的AI创业,真能靠“爱好”逆天改命? 谁能想到,一个单纯痴迷本地大模型的普通爱好者,仅凭一场“不计成本”的钻研,竟打造出被巨头以1065万收购的初创公司,从刷爆信用卡凑服务器钱的困境,一跃成为AI赛道的黑马创业者。他的故事,不仅戳中了无数技术爱好者的创业…

作者头像 李华
网站建设 2026/6/10 12:02:24

最近在搞电动汽车电驱系统仿真,发现查表法在永磁同步电机控制里真是个宝藏方法。今天咱们就手把手搭个Simulink模型,看看这法子怎么在动态工况下秀操作

基于查表法的电动汽车用永磁同步电机电驱动控制matlab仿真模型,Simulink 。先说说查表法的核心——提前把各种工况下的最佳控制参数算好存成表格,运行时直接调取。这对车载ECU这种计算资源有限的场景特别友好。比如转速环和电流环的PI参数,现…

作者头像 李华
网站建设 2026/6/10 12:01:47

5.4 故障诊断与处理:快速定位和解决线上问题

5.4 故障诊断与处理:快速定位和解决线上问题 📚 学习目标 通过本节学习,你将掌握: ✅ 系统化的故障诊断方法和流程 ✅ 常见故障类型(性能、可用性、数据完整性、安全)的诊断 ✅ 应急响应和故障处理流程 ✅ 故障预防和监控体系建设 ✅ 故障复盘和经验总结方法 🎯 学习…

作者头像 李华
网站建设 2026/6/10 12:02:10

面试必看:优势洗牌

贪心双指针求解优势洗牌问题(C 实现) 题目描述 给定两个长度相等的数组 nums1 和 nums2,定义 nums1 相对于 nums2 的优势为满足 nums1[i] > nums2[i] 的索引 i 的数量。要求返回 nums1 的任意一个排列,使得该排列相对于 nums2 …

作者头像 李华